The Return of Automatic Slim Tour: Dates & Cities

Erykah Badu’s recent Abi & Alan Luv Is Tour with The Alchemist broke new ground by premiering their first full collaborative album "Abi & Alan" live before the music hit any streaming platform, creating intimate, listening-party-style shows. Badu and her band, The Cannabinoids, fused analog warmth and digital textures in venues designed for presence and immersion.

Now, for fans of legacy and celebration, her Mama’s Gun ’25: The Return of Automatic Slim Tour offers a sweeping tribute. This anniversary Erykah Badu concert tour launches October 3 at the Hollywood Bowl and wraps December 10 at The Pavilion at The Pavilion at Toyota Music Factory in Dallas. Along the way, she brings her powerful voice and uncanny storytelling to major cities including Las Vegas, Atlantic City, Boston, Detroit, Brooklyn, Atlanta, Nashville, Houston, and Chicago.


From "On & On" to "Tyrone": Erykah Badu Concert Info

An Erykah Badu concert is less about a rigid setlist and more about the vibe, which is exactly what makes her shows legendary. Fans can count on hearing essential Erykah Badu tracks like "On & On," "Bag Lady," "Tyrone," "Didn’t Cha Know?", and "Love of My Life (An Ode to Hip Hop)." Still, don’t expect them in their original form: Badu is known to deconstruct and rebuild her songs onstage, fusing them with extended jams, covers, or improvisational twists. Classics like "Otherside of the Game" and "Window Seat" often appear at her shows, while The Cannabinoids turns every performance into a living, breathing groove. No two nights are alike, and that unpredictability is part of the magic.

Who is Erykah Badu?

Erykah Badu is a solo artist from Dallas that has reached superstar status across the r&b/soul, neo-soul, and indie soul categories. Erykah Badu has released 8 live and studio albums and 17 singles on Spotify that string all the way back to Jan 1, 1997 with her debut album titled Baduizm. Her most recent album release was But You Caint Use My Phone (Mixtape) on Nov 27, 2015.

Erykah Badu's RIAA Awards

Erykah Badu has reached the pinnacle of any artist's career by earning an RIAA award. Her top award came on Jun 27, 2000 for her album Baduizm. She received a Multi-Platinum award for the album. In total, Erykah Badu has 2 Multi-Platinum albums. That's not all though. Erykah Badu has been fortunate enough to achieve a Platinum award for one more album. Even with all of this success, her RIAA collection finishes with 4 additional Gold albums.
